| This study was performed to evaluate the effect of lactococcin BZ and enterocin KP against Listeria monocytogenes ATCC 7644 in skim (0.1%), half (1.5%), and full fat (3.0%) UHT milks. The milk samples were inoculated with L. monocytogenes at the level of approximately 2.60, 4.76, and 6.45 log CFU ml −1 , and then treated with various concentrations (400, 800, 1600, or 2500 AU ml −1 ) of lactococcin BZ, enterocin KP, or their combination (1:1). Lactococcin BZ at 400–2500 AU ml −1 level displayed strong antilisterial activity, and decreased the viable cell numbers of L. monocytogenes to an undetectable level in all types of milk samples during the entire storage periods at 4 °C or 20 °C.
